This is a fully remote position, open to applicants in South Carolina.
• Deliver specialized high school special education course content in an online setting.
• Provide instruction, support, and guidance tailored to meet the individual needs of students as outlined in each student’s IEP.
• Collaborate with parents and related service personnel to ensure the delivery of appropriate therapies and services.
• Develop compliant IEPs, progress reports, and necessary documentation related to special education.
• Facilitate collaborative special education meetings, including annual IEP meetings.
• Implement accommodations and modifications utilizing assistive technology, supplemental curriculum, and accessible text.
• Adapt Stride K12 lessons and assessments in accordance with IEP specifications.
• Ensure student inclusion and success within the general education classroom.
• Gather data and work samples to monitor progress towards IEP objectives.
• Document parent communications and student interventions.
• Analyze student data to recommend remediation and enrichment strategies.
• Provide both synchronous and asynchronous learning experiences.
• Maintain the grade book and uphold student academic integrity.
• Make decisions regarding student placement and promotion, alerting administrators to any performance issues.
• Prepare students for high-stakes standardized assessments.
• Establish a positive rapport with families and ensure timely communication with students and parents.
• Assist learning coaches and parents with curricular, instructional, and basic virtual classroom troubleshooting issues.
